How to train your yorkie

According to figures released in January by the American Kennel Club, the Yorkshire Terrier is the second most popular breed in the country, surpassed by the Labrador Retriever. “But being number two is not the natural disposition of a Yorkie,” says dog trainer Rick Bell. Bell says Yorkies can be “tiny dictators” if a pet owner allows them to rule the house.

Bell suggests that Yorkie owners take a couple of simple steps so that the fur pellet understands who the boss really is. “First of all, do not carry your Yorkie unless it is in an area where it is impossible for him to walk,” says Bell. “If you treat your puppy like a prince or princess, he will develop a pampered attitude.”

“Second, walk your Yorkie every day, with you leading and he or she following you. Walking is what canines do in the wild, all day long, and leaders always lead. As the saying goes for a dog sled team, be the leader, the view is better. “

“Third, don’t paper train a Yorkie to get away. They are difficult enough to do without adding an extra step. If you ignore this advice, you may end up leaving paper for the next 15 years.”

“Fourth, be calm, assertive, and consistent in enforcing the rules you set. With Yorkies, you will also need to add a lot of patience. As a breed, they are brave, stubborn, and tenacious. Due to these tendencies, it would also be wise to avoid the tug of war as a game activity. Why? Because you will be bored before the dog and off the field. With that action, you will teach them that they can get what they want to want simply by being persistent.

Bell says it’s important to remember his last words of advice: “They never follow kind leaders and they never follow righteous leaders. They only follow dominant leaders. If you want to avoid being the follower, then be dominant.”
